Webb16.3 Philosophenproblem und Deadlocks 153 KAPITEL 17: PROZESSMODELLIERUNG 155 17.1 Darstellung paralleler Prozesse durch Petrinetze 155 17.2 Petrinetze - Aufbau, Funktionsweise und Regeln 157 17.3 Nebenläufigkeit und Synchronisation 160 17.4 Konflikte und deren Lösung 163 17.5 Simulation von Prozessabläufen 167 WebbDas Philosophen-Problem Ein klassisches Problem für nebenläufige Prozesse ist das Problem der Philosophen: n Philosophen sitzen am runden Tisch mit n Gabeln. Jeder Philosoph erlebt der Reihe nach folgende drei Zustände: "Denken", "Hungrig" und "Essen". Zum Denken braucht er keine Gabel.
PhilosophenProblem/Philosoph.java at master · knaeckeKami
WebbDer Dekker-Algorithmus (nach Theodorus Dekker) ist wie der Peterson-Algorithmus eine vollständige Lösung des Problems, den wechselseitigen Ausschluss (Mutex) in der dezentralen Steuerung von Prozessen (Prozesssynchronisation) zu gewährleisten. 6 Beziehungen: Algorithmus von Peterson, Dekker, Mutex, Philosophenproblem, … WebbZeigt eine Lösung des "PhilosophenProblems" mit konfiguriebarer Anzahl von Philosophen und Runden - PhilosophenProblem/Philosoph.java at master · … diabetes reason
Das Philosophen-Problem - BHT Berlin
WebbPhilosophenproblem (Dining-philosopher problem) • im Kreis sitzende Philosophen benötigen das Besteck der Nachbarn zum Essen Schlafende Friseure (Sleeping-barber problem) • Friseure schlafen solange keine Kunden da sind 101. Systemprogrammierung I D Webbinterferieren. Typisch für Probleme dieser Art sind das Philosophenproblem von Dijkstra [Dijkstra71] und das Zigarettenraucherproblem von Patil [Patil]. Das Problem des symmetrischen zeitlichen Ausschlusses ist wie folgt spezifi ziert: 109 WebbBeim Philosophenproblem handelt es sich um ein Fallbeispiel aus dem Bereich der theoretischen Informatik. Damit soll das Problem der Nebenläufigkeit und die Gefahr der … diabetes - readmission prediction